Custom Built - One of a kind, 63 foot Center Cockpit Ketch designed by Allen Erickson and built by Stuart Yacht Builders, Stuart Florida. She was built for the -- ONLY OWNER -- with great attention to detail and no limit on time or expense to complete the custom build in 1983. She has a conventional encapsulated lead keel with skeg hung rudder. Hull is solid FRP construction and over 2 inches thick. She is a cutter rigged ketch with roller furling Genoa and Staysail and Hood in-mast furling systems in both main and mizzen masts. Main mast is stepped on the keel and mizzen mast is stepped on a permanent glassed-in athwart-ships bulkhead.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

Pros

Spacious Interior: The Stuart 63 offers an expansive living space, making it ideal for long cruises or extended stays. The layout typically includes multiple cabins, providing ample room for family or guests.

Strong Build Quality: Crafted with durability in mind, the design and construction of the Stuart 63 are robust, allowing it to handle various sea conditions confidently.

Traditional Ketch Rigging: The ketch rig provides versatility in sail handling, enabling easier management of sails in various wind conditions, which is great for cruising.

Good Performance: Known for its sailing performance, the Stuart 63 can provide a balanced and responsive experience, making it suitable for both amateur sailors and seasoned cruisers.

Storage Capacity: With its roomy design, there is plenty of storage for gear, provisions, and personal items, making it practical for longer voyages.

Classic Aesthetics: The classic ketch design is appealing and timeless, offering a distinguished look on the water.

Cons

Age Considerations: Being a boat from 1983, potential buyers should consider the effects of age on the vessel, including the need for updates or maintenance on systems and equipment.

Maintenance Requirements: Older boats may require more frequent upkeep and repairs, particularly with the rigging, engine, and electronics, which can be costly and time-consuming.

Less Modern Amenities: The interior and onboard technology may not match the conveniences and efficiency of newer models, which could be a disadvantage for those seeking modern luxury.

Sail Handling: While the ketch rig offers advantages, it can also be more complex to manage compared to a sloop rig, requiring a higher level of skill and experience in more challenging sailing conditions.

Initial Cost: While it can be a great investment, the initial cost of purchasing a well-kept Stuart 63 can be significant, especially if it comes with extensive amenities or upgrades.

Limited Availability of Parts: As with any older vessel, finding replacement parts or specific components may be more difficult, potentially leading to challenges in maintenance.
